Recognizing Content Overload

One of the first steps in overcoming content fatigue is recognizing the signals that your audience is approaching burnout. These warning signs include:

  • Declining email open rates
  • Decreasing click-through rates
  • Reduced social media engagement
  • Increasing unsubscribe rates
  • Rising website bounce rates
  • Shorter time-on-page metrics
  • Negative sentiment in comments

According to research published by the Economist Group, consumer attention spans continue to dwindle in the face of ever-increasing promotional messages. In this environment, continuously churning out more content without strategic purpose can be counterproductive. A better approach involves thoughtful content pacing to ensure each piece delivers genuine value.

Strategically Using AI Content Strategies

AI-driven tools can transform how you produce and refine marketing materials. When implemented thoughtfully, these tools help prevent content fatigue in several key ways:

1. Efficient Topic Research and Planning

AI solutions excel at analyzing enormous data sets to uncover trending topics, search terms, and conversation patterns. Rather than relying on guesswork, you can quickly identify which themes are resonating with your target audience. This data-driven approach keeps your content aligned with real-time interests, reducing the risk of producing repetitive or irrelevant material.

2. Informed Message Personalization

Personalized messages consistently generate stronger engagement than generic content. AI platforms help tailor your tone, structure, and subject matter to match diverse audience segments or target industries. When messages speak directly to each reader’s unique challenges, audience burnout decreases because every piece feels timely and relevant.

3. Content Optimization and Testing

AI tools can analyze performance data to determine which content elements drive engagement. This allows you to refine your approach based on actual audience behavior rather than assumptions. By understanding which formats, topics, and distribution channels perform best, you can focus your efforts where they’ll have the greatest impact.

However, achieving a balanced content approach requires more than running automated prompts. If you rely solely on AI to generate content without strategic oversight, your brand voice may lose its distinctive edge. Thoughtful implementation and consistent review are crucial for preserving authenticity.

Monitoring Performance and Adapting

Keeping content fresh is an ongoing process that requires regular performance monitoring. Rather than setting a rigid publishing schedule and hoping for the best, flexible analysis ensures your team remains responsive to audience signals. Useful tactics include:

  • Frequent Engagement Audits: Track open rates, click-through rates, time on site, and social shares. If a piece underperforms, investigate why before repeating similar content.
  • Analytics Dashboards: Use analytics platforms to visualize trends at a glance, highlighting which formats or topics resonate most. Pivot quickly when patterns indicate audience burnout.
  • Feedback Loops: Gather reader input through polls or comments to gauge satisfaction and collect fresh perspectives. This helps in refining both messaging and scheduling.
  • Competitive Analysis: Monitor competitor content to identify gaps and opportunities in your market. This can reveal untapped topics and formats that will feel fresh to your audience.

Additionally, remember that sustainable content creation isn’t about constant production. It’s about modulating velocity so your audience can fully absorb and appreciate each conversation you initiate.

Ensuring Long-Term Audience Engagement

Long-term success hinges on continuously refining your process. Today’s platforms allow updates to happen quickly, but your strategy should still be grounded in a long-term vision. Consider these approaches for lasting engagement:

Rotating Content Types

Use a healthy mix of blog articles, short-form videos, infographics, and interactive posts. Variety helps you appeal to different learning styles and keeps your overall message fresh. This approach prevents your audience from becoming accustomed to and eventually tuning out a single content format.

Setting Realistic Publishing Cadences

If daily social posts feel excessive, scale back to a more comfortable frequency and focus on meaningful conversations. Quality consistently overshadows quantity, especially in an age of information overload. Determine the optimal publishing rhythm for each channel based on audience behavior and your team’s capacity.

Offering Depth and Value

When your content routinely provides real takeaways or unique insights, people are more willing to stay engaged and watch for updates. This minimizes audience turnover and builds a loyal following. Focus on solving real problems and answering genuine questions rather than creating content for its own sake.

Building Community Around Content

Transform passive consumers into active participants by fostering community discussion. Encourage comments, create user-generated content opportunities, and acknowledge audience contributions. This two-way exchange keeps engagement high and provides continuous inspiration for fresh content angles.
